TIME NOT WORKED. The Employer will be under no obligation to pay for any day not worked upon which the Employee is required to present for duty, except where the absence from work is due to illness and comes within the provisions of Clause 28 – Personal Leave of this Agreement, or such absence is on account of any other form of leave to which the Employee is entitled under the provisions of this Agreement.
